In 1993, Weaver and his wife founded a non-profit group called Institute of Ecolonomics a word he coined from combining ecology and economics to discover solutions to environmental issues. Since 1990, he and Stowell had lived in an earth ship: an almost 100,000-square-foot, solar-powered home in Ridgway made from 3,000 recycled tires and 300,000 tin and aluminum cans. As a struggling actor, his big break came in 1955 with a $300-per-week job in the television western series "Gunsmoke," as Chester Goode, the limping, humorous colleague to the United States Marshall, Matt Dillion played by James Arness. It was his big break; the show went on to become the highest-rated and longest-running live action series in United States television history (1955 to 1975). Dennis Weaver was a vegetarian since 1958[12] and student of yoga and meditation since the 1960s and a devoted follower of Paramahansa Yogananda, the Indian guru who established the Self-Realization Fellowship in the United States.
